DebugBundle captures production errors and packages the available evidence into agent-ready debug bundles. Each structured, versioned JSON artifact brings together the failure and captured request, log, runtime, and release context, so developers and coding agents can inspect what happened...

Tunngle 5 features
DebugBundle 0 features
  • Easy to Use
    Tunngle offers a user-friendly interface that makes it simple for users of different technical backgrounds to set up and join virtual networks.
  • Strong Community Support
    It boasts an active community that can help troubleshoot issues, share tips, and provide support for a wide range of games.
  • Specialized Gaming Features
    Provides features specifically tailored for gamers, such as chat rooms, game-specific rooms, and integrated social tools.
  • High-Security Standards
    Offers robust encryption to ensure secure connections between users, which is crucial for maintaining privacy during online activities.
  • Versatile Networking Options
    Supports various network configurations and allows users to create their own private virtual networks for different use cases.

Possible disadvantages

  • Shut Down in 2018
    Tunngle officially shut down its services on April 30, 2018, which means it is no longer available for new users or updates.
  • Dependency on Software Installation
    Requires the installation of client software on each participating device, which may be inconvenient for some users.
  • Compatibility Issues
    Users may experience compatibility problems with certain operating systems or network configurations, which could hinder functionality.
  • Potential Latency Issues
    Like many VPN services, it can introduce latency, which may affect the performance of online games and applications.
  • Network Stability
    Sometimes users reported instability in network connections, which could interrupt gaming sessions and other activities.
